绘制线性图gsn_csm_xy呢还是地图gsn_csm_contour_map呢? 熟悉数据属性 什么叫熟悉数据属性?比如你手中有一组降水数据,那么你首先要了解它是站点数据还是再分析数据?是nc文件还是grib文件又或者是txt文件? 然后根据属性进行读取 nc文件:f=addfile(path,"r") txt文件: f=asciiread(filename,-1,"string") 了解...
plot(1) = gsn_csm_xy(wks,xtimes,var2_m,res1) ; === res@xyLineColor = "red" res@xyLineThicknessF = 5. ; for higher quality large image res@tiYAxisString = var3name res@tiYAxisFontColor = res@xyLineColor res@tmYLLabelFontColor = res@xyLineColor res@tiYAxisFontHeightF = 0.05 ...
绘制线性图gsn_csm_xy呢还是地图gsn_csm_contour_map呢? 熟悉数据属性 什么叫熟悉数据属性?比如你手中有一组降水数据,那么你首先要了解它是站点数据还是再分析数据?是nc文件还是grib文件又或者是txt文件? 然后根据属性进行读取 nc文件:f=addfile(path,"r") txt文件: f= asciiread(filename,-1,"string") 了...
res@xyLineThicknesses = (/6.0,6.0,6.0,6.0/) ;设置曲线粗细 res@xyDashPattern = 0 ;设置曲线线型 res@trYMaxF = 25 ;设置y轴最大值 res@trYMinF = -25 ;设置y轴最小值 plot =gsn_csm_xy(wks,x,y,res) ;绘制曲线,此处x为1维矩阵,y可以是多维矩阵,要求y的列数与x的列数相同 内容所属专栏...
根据你想绘制图形选择合适的绘图函数,一般都选择gsn_csm_xxx的绘图接口函数,因为它们会比一般的gsn_xxx绘图接口函数多更多的默认设置,我们可以少设置很多属性,能更快完成我们想要的“标准”图形。如: xy = gsn_csm_xy(wks,x,y,res) plot = gsn_csm_contour(wks,data,res) ...
根据你想绘制图形选择合适的绘图函数,一般都选择gsn_csm_xxx的绘图接口函数,因为它们会比一般的gsn_xxx绘图接口函数多更多的默认设置,我们可以少设置很多属性,能更快完成我们想要的“标准”图形。如: xy = gsn_csm_xy(wks,x,y,res) plot = gsn_csm_contour(wks,data,res) ...
⼀|NCL中最常⽤的六种属性: 1、xy(xy plot)2、cn(contour plot)3、vc(vector plot)4、ti(title)5、tm(tickmark)6、lb(labelbar)⼆|含义: 1、gsn(getting started using ncl)2、csm(climate system model)3、res(resources)=True:Indicate you want to set some resources.4、xwks=gsn_open_...
确保你的脚本文件是以.ncl为后缀,并且其中的代码符合NCL的语法规则。例如,一个简单的NCL脚本可能如下所示: ncl begin wks = gsn_open_wks("x11","Test Plot") x = (/1,2,3,4,5/) y = (/10,20,25,30,40/) plot = gsn_csm_xy(wks,x,y) draw(plot) frame(wks) end 打开命令行终端: 在...
plot = gsn_csm_xy(wks, data, True) ; 显示图形 draw(plot) ; 保存图像 frame(wks) end “` 3. 运行NCL+脚本:使用终端或命令行界面进入到存储NCL+脚本的目录中,然后使用以下命令运行NCL+脚本: “` ncl script.ncl “` 其中,`script.ncl`是你需要运行的NCL+脚本的文件名。
在绘制线条时,我们可以使用`gsn_csm_xy`函数来创建一个基本的线条图,并通过一些参数来控制线条的绘制顺序。 res=True res@gsLineThicknessF=2.0;设置线条的粗细 res@gsLineLabelThicknessF=2.0;设置线条标签的粗细 res@gsLineOpacityF=1.0;设置线条的透明度 res@gsLineDashPattern=False;禁用虚线模式 res@gsLine...